Maguire struck in the 26th minute, following a brilliant Jacob Hazel assist, to hand United all three points at the Jakemans Community Stadium.
The result lifted the Pilgrims five points clear of the bottom four - with four matches to play.
United were unchanged from their midweek success over Aldershot Town but it was the visitors who made the brighter start.
Matty Kosylo robbed possession in a dangerous area, but was unable to pick out Regan Linney, and the same two players were involved a couple of minutes later with Linney's cross rattling the post and Cameron Gregory making a brilliant save on the follow-up to deny Kosylo.
United responded strongly and Connor Teale's effort on the spin cleared Caleb Ansen's crossbar, before Jai Rowe saw a header clip the top of the post - with Ansen grabbing the loose ball.
The Pilgrims edged ahead when Hazel showed excellent poise to pick out the run of MAGUIRE, who took the ball down, jinked infield and beat Ansen with a clinical, low left-footed drive from 12 yards.
Ansen subsequently denied Dylan Hill and Hazel to keep Altrincham in the contest at half-time.
Callum Dolan fired narrowly off target for the visitors on the stroke of half-time, but the second half was a cagier affair, with chances at a premium.
Altrincham probably should have levelled in the 72nd minute when substitute James Jones cushioned a neat ball into the box before losing his composure and firing over the top from 12 yards.
United held on relatively stress-free thereafter, as their survival mission stepped up another notch in front of a jubilant Jakemans Community Stadium home crowd.
